Goshen High School provides a comprehensive curriculum that includes the four core areas of Mathematics, English, Science, and Social Studies. There are courses at both the Honors and the College Prep levels. Courses are available in foreign languages as well as art, vocal and instrumental music, business, and technology. Additional elective choices are available through a building flex-credit program. At risk students are served through the Career Based Intervention, Warrior Path, and ACE programs. There are seven Advanced Placement (AP) courses offered in addition to four dual-credit courses that are offered in conjunction with Zane State College and Southern State College. A small number of students are served at UC Clermont College through the College Credit Plus program. Goshen High School has been consistently rated Excellent by the state of Ohio. The school has been through some dramatic changes in its curriculum over the past five years. Added were the four dual enrollment courses for our students to take advantage of earning college credit while in high school. Dual-Credit Chemistry, Western Civilization, Sociology, and Art History to the repertoire of classes. We have also added a number of new AP courses to our master schedule. Students now have the opportunity to take Biology, US History, Psychology, Calculus, Government, and English Language at the Advanced Placement level.
